What is a Dosing System?

A dosing system is an automated setup that accurately measures and delivers controlled amounts of a substance into a process. Typically involved in chemical and water treatment industries, these systems ensure the precise introduction of liquids to achieve the desired outcomes, improving process efficiency and consistency.

Components of a Dosing System

A typical dosing system comprises several components designed to work harmoniously for optimal performance:

  • Dosing Pumps: At the heart of any dosing system is the dosing pump, responsible for delivering the precise volume of liquid at specified intervals. Different types, such as diaphragm, peristaltic, or piston pumps, are chosen based on the specific requirements of the application.
  • Control Units: These electronic gadgets manage the operational parameters of the dosing system, including the frequency and volume of doses. Modern systems even incorporate IoT for increased connectivity and control.
  • Storage Tanks: Specialized tanks store the chemicals or liquids to be dosed, ensuring a steady supply throughout the process.

Applications of Dosing Pumps

The versatility of dosing pumps makes them indispensable across various industries:

  • Water Treatment: In wastewater treatment, dosing pumps introduce specific chemicals that help in purifying the water, such as chlorine or pH regulators.
  • Food and Beverage: Ensuring product consistency and safety, these pumps accurately inject flavors, preservatives, and colorants into products.
  • Pharmaceuticals: Dosing pumps facilitate precise drug formulations by dispensing exact chemical quantities needed for production.

Benefits of Implementing Dosing Systems

The appeal of dosing systems extends beyond precision. Here are some of the significant advantages:

  • Enhanced Accuracy: Minimize human error and achieve exact quantification, ensuring quality and compliance with regulatory standards.
  • Cost Efficiency: With reduced waste and optimized use of materials, companies can see substantial cost savings.
  • Operational Flexibility: Dosing systems can be tailored to diverse applications, allowing seamless integration into various operational scales.
